Slow Cooker Sticky Toffee Pudding

Written by Foodie Fee | Dec 1, 2017 3:57:11 PM

This recipe for Slow Cooker Sticky Toffee Pudding is simple and tasty and I wouldn’t dream of making it any other way!

Recipe:

Sticky Toffee Pudding

Ingredients

Measure

Self Raising Flour

250g

Dark Brown Sugar

200g

Bicarbonate of Soda

1 tsp

Carnation Caramel Sauce

125g

Medjool Dates (stoned & chopped)

200g

Ground Ginger

3 tsp

Melted Butter

75g

Treacle

2 tbsp

Full Fat Milk

100ml

 

Caramel Sauce

Ingredients

Measure

Dark Brown Sugar

300g

Melted Butter

50g

Boiling Water

450ml

 

Topping

Ingredients

Measure

Carnation Caramel Sauce

272g

 

Method:

1)  Lightly grease the slow cooker bowl with butter

2)  Put the flour, sugar, bicarbonate of soda, ginger and chopped dates into a bowl and stir well to mix the ingredients

3)  In a separate bowl, whisk together eggs, melted butter, treacle, milk and 125g of the caramel sauce (it may look curdled but don’t panic!)

4)  Add the wet mixture to the dry mixture, ensure that it is mixed thoroughly

5)  Pour the mixture into the slow cooker

6)  To make the caramel sauce, combine water, butter and sugar and gently pour over the mixture in the slow cooker

7)  Cook on high for 2 hours

8)  Once it has risen and is firm, pour over the remaining  tinned caramel sauce as a topping and cook for a further 30mins

9)  Switch off, remove the lid and leave for 10 mins until the sauce has thickened

10)  Serve with ice cream or thick double cream
